How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lowry Hill?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Lowry Hill Studio Apartments | $1,100 | $850 | $1,545 |
Lowry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,498 | $975 | $2,030 |
Lowry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,441 | $1,425 | $3,430 |

Cheapest Available Lowry Hill Studio Apartments
Currently the lowest priced Studio apartment unit Lowry Hill of Minneapolis, MN is the 0BR/1.0BA Model starting from $850 at 2009 Bryant Ave S. The average price for all Studio apartments in Lowry Hill is currently $1,100.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in the area: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
2009 Bryant Ave S | 0BR/1.0BA | $850 |
Lowry Hill Apartments | Studio | $915 |
PERIS Hill | 0E | $999 |
PURE Lowry | Affordable Unit | $1,095 |
MoDI Apartments | 0BR/1.0BA | $1,099 |
